Discveries at the famus Sanxingdui ruins in Suthwest China shw that the regin’s ancient Shu Kingdm Civilizatin shared similarities with the Maya.
The Sanxingdui ruins belnged t the Shu Kingdm that existed at least 4,800 years ag and lasted mre than 2,000 years, while the Mayan civilizatin built its city-states arund 200 AD.
The brnze-made remains f trees unearthed at the ruins f the Shu Kingdm resemble the sacred ceiba tree, which symblized the unin f heaven, earth and the underwrld in the Mayan civilizatin. “They are very imprtant similarities,” says Sants, a Mexican archaelgist (考古學(xué)家) stressing that “the representatins f trees in bth cultures prvide a symblism that is very similar”.
The findings at the Sanxingdui ruins, cnsidered ne f the greatest archaelgical discveries f the 20th century, als shw a new aspect f Brnze Age culture, indicating the ancient civilizatin already had technlgies that were thught t have been develped much later.
While the time span between the Shu kingdm and the Mayan culture is great, the findings highlight the clseness between the tw civilizatins. They develped in areas with cmparable climates and reflected their wrldview thrugh related symbls. “In the end, man is still man, independent f time and space. What we have is that, at this latitude (緯度), bth the Shu peple and the Mayans lked at the same sky and had the same stars n the hrizn,” the expert says.
One ntable feature f the recent discveries at Sanxingdui was the crss-subject wrk and technlgy applied by teams f Chinese archaelgists, which allwed the unearthing f artifacts as fragile as silk remains, which ther types f less careful digging methds wuld nt have been able t register.
Cperatin between Chinese and Mexican archaelgists culd benefit prjects in the Mayan wrld, where the rainy climate and humidity are prblematic fr the cnservatin f ruins.
“Every time ur cultural knwledge increases, regardless f whether we speak ne language r anther, what it shws us is that we cntinue t be sister cultures and, therefre, the exchange f such knwledge is fundamental,” says Sants.

Several years ag, Jasn Bx, a scientist frm Ohi, flew 31 giant rlls f white plastic t a glacier (冰川) in Greenland. He and his team spread them acrss 10,000 feet f ice, then left. His idea was that the white blanket wuld reflect back the rays f the sun, keeping the ice cl belw. When he came back t check the results, he fund it wrked. Expsed ice had melted faster than cvered ice. He had nt nly saved tw feet f glacier in a shrt time. N cal plants were shut dwn, n jbs were lst, and nbdy was taxed r fired. Just the srt f fix we’re lking fr.
“Thank yu, but n thank yu.” says Ralph King, a climate scientist. He tld Grey Childs. authr and cmmentatr, that peple think technlgy can save the planet, “but there are ther things we need t deal with, like cnsumptin. They burned $50,000 just fr the helicpter” t bring the plastic t the glacier. This experiment, qute-unqute, gives peple false hpe that climate change can be fixed withut changing human behavir. It can’t. Technlgy wn’t give us a free ride.
Individuals respnd t climate change differently. Climatlgist Kelly Smith is hardly alne in her predictin that smeday sn we wn’t be climate victims, we will be climate Chsers. Mre scientists agree with her that if the human race survives. The engineers will get smarter, the tls will get better, and ne day we will cntrl the climate. but that then? “Just the mentin f us cntrlling the climate sent a small shiver dwn my back, Grey writes.” “Smething sunded wrng abut stpping ice by ur wn will,” he says.
Me? I like it better when the earth takes care f itself, I guess ne day we will have t run the place, but fr the mment, sitting at my desk, lking ut at the trees bending wildly and the wind hwling, I’m happy nt t be in charge.
